#e96fbc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e96fbc is composed of 91.4% red, 43.5%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52.4% magenta, 19.3%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 322.1 degrees, a saturation of 73.5% and a lightness of 67.5%. #e96fbc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deff with #d30079.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

Shades and Tints of #e96fbc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090106 is the darkest color, while #fef7f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#e96fbc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b0a8ad is the less saturated color, while #fc5cc1 is the most saturated one.
